26 February 2020
Written question
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, what guidance his Department has provided to employers with staff who have recently returned from areas with prominent cases of covid-19.
Source: Commons
6 March 2020
Answer
The Department and Public Health England have advised that individuals returning from travel to high-risk areas should self-isolate at their residence and call NHS 111 for advice. Guidance for employers and businesses is available online and includes advi...
